Location & Nearby Attractions

image from hipcamp, Lava Rock Cabin ~ Off Grid Hale

This charming cabin is located in Mountain View, Hawaii, right at the heart of the island’s natural beauty. Being just 30 minutes from Hawaiʻi Volcanoes National Park, it’s a prime lodging option for hikers and nature lovers alike. You can easily hop in your car and head out to explore one of the most unique volcanic landscapes on the planet.

Nearby Attractions

Let’s not forget about all the nearby attractions that’ll keep you entertained! Just a short 25-minute drive away, you’ll find the famous Volcanoes National Park. Offering endless hiking opportunities and stunning views, it’s a must-visit for anyone staying in the area. There’s nothing quite like walking among the lava fields and taking in the might of Kilauea volcano!

If you’re looking to cool off, there are also several beaches and waterfalls within close range. Places like Isaac Hale Beach Park and Punalu’u Beach Park provide a perfect backdrop for swimming, snorkeling, and soaking up the sun. Just imagine relaxing on the beach after a long hike—pure bliss!

Pros and Cons of Lava Rock Cabin ~ Off Grid Hale

image from hipcamp, Lava Rock Cabin ~ Off Grid Hale

Pros: What We Loved

Amenities: This cabin offers all the essentials for a comfy stay, including hot water showers and a fully stocked kitchen. It’s great not having to compromise the comforts we rely on.

Location: The proximity to Volcanoes National Park is a huge plus for nature enthusiasts! You can set out for epic hikes early in the morning.

Host Experience: The host, Sanna, is top-notch! She offers fantastic local tips and makes sure guests feel right at home.

Cons: What Could Be Better

Remote Location: While the seclusion is great, it may not suit everyone. If you’re the type who enjoys being close to convenience stores and bustling streets, keep this in mind.

Wildlife: The beautiful nature comes with its fair share of critters! Some guests reported minor issues with insects and critters getting into food, so be sure to pack your food strategically.

Solar Power Limitations: Being off-grid means relying on solar power, which can be challenging during overcast days. Be prepared for possible outages but trust me, it adds to the experience!

Things to Know Before You Go

There are a few things to keep in mind before you pack your bags for this amazing adventure. First and foremost, it’s essential to embrace the off-grid lifestyle! Make sure to bring enough food and supplies, as the nearest stores are a 15-20 minute drive away. A little bit of meal planning goes a long way!

Also, don’t forget about the need to respect the wildlife. With the natural environment so close, it’s a good idea to pack food securely to avoid unwelcome guests—bear-proof containers or resealable bags work wonders!

Bring a flashlight for nighttime adventures or strolls around the property. Even though the cabin is designed to be cozy and warm, it can get really dark out there, so a little light goes a long way!

Lastly, it’s always a good idea to check the weather ahead of time, particularly if your travels involve hiking excursions. Be prepared for sudden changes in weather; layering your clothing is key! Make sure your gear is adjusted to handle potential rain since tropical showers can pop up now and then.
